Factors to Consider When Choosing Linoleum Carving Sets For Block Print

Choosing the right linoleum carving set involves more than just price. Key factors include the quality of the blades, comfort of the handles, and the variety of tools offered. Considering your experience level and project complexity can help determine whether a simple starter kit or a comprehensive set is best. Additionally, think about the durability of the tools and how easy they are to maintain or replace over time. By understanding these factors, you can make a more informed decision that supports your creative growth.

Blade Quality and Variety

High-quality blades are essential for clean cuts and precise detailing. Look for sets that include different shapes and sizes, such as gouges and V-tools, to handle various design elements. Cheaper blades may dull quickly or break easily, affecting your workflow and results. Investing in a set with a range of blades ensures flexibility and saves money over time, especially if you plan to do frequent carving.

Comfort and Ergonomics

Carving can be strenuous, so ergonomic handles are a key consideration. Handles that fit comfortably in your hand reduce fatigue and improve control, especially during extended sessions. Some sets feature cushioned grips or contoured designs, which are worth paying extra for if you carve regularly. Avoid overly small or hard handles that can cause discomfort or slips.

Completeness of the Kit

Decide whether you want just the tools or a full kit with inks, brayers, and other accessories. Beginners often benefit from all-in-one sets that include basic supplies, making it easier to start without additional purchases. More experienced carvers might prefer selecting individual tools for customization. Be aware that some kits may include surplus or less useful items, so consider what really adds value for your specific project needs.

Durability and Maintenance

Tools that last through frequent use are worth investing in, especially for those who carve regularly. Look for sets with blades made from hardened steel or high-quality alloys, which resist dulling and corrosion. Proper maintenance, like cleaning and storing blades safely, extends their lifespan. Cheaper or poorly made tools might need frequent replacements, increasing long-term costs.

Price and Value

The best set for you balances cost against quality and scope. Basic kits are suitable for casual hobbyists, while more expensive options offer higher durability and a broader tool selection for serious artists. Consider how often you carve and your skill level: investing more upfront can save money over time if you carve frequently. Conversely, if you’re just starting, a modest kit can be a smart, budget-friendly choice.

Frequently Asked Questions

Should I buy a complete kit or individual tools?

For beginners, a complete kit often provides everything needed to start, including blades, inks, and accessories. This approach simplifies the purchasing process and ensures compatibility among components. More experienced carvers may prefer individual tools to customize their setup, selecting higher-quality blades or specialized tools suited to their specific projects. Consider your skill level and whether you want to expand your toolkit over time.

How important are ergonomic handles in carving sets?

Ergonomic handles significantly influence comfort and control during carving. They reduce hand fatigue and improve precision, especially during longer sessions. Handles with cushioned grips or contoured shapes are generally more comfortable and safer, helping prevent slips. If you plan to carve often or for extended periods, prioritizing ergonomic design can make a noticeable difference in your experience and results.

What’s the best way to maintain my carving tools?

Proper maintenance involves cleaning blades after each use to prevent rust and corrosion, and storing them in a dry, safe place. Sharpening blades periodically keeps cuts clean and precise, extending their lifespan. Some carvers use honing stones or specialized sharpeners designed for steel blades. Regular upkeep ensures your tools stay in top condition, saving you money and frustration over time.

Are more expensive sets worth the investment?

Higher-priced sets often feature better materials, more durable blades, and ergonomic designs that enhance comfort and control. They tend to last longer and perform better over repeated use, making them suitable for serious hobbyists or professionals. However, if you’re a beginner or only carving occasionally, a mid-range or budget set can provide good value without the higher price tag. Consider your frequency of use and long-term goals when evaluating cost versus quality.

Can I use these sets for other types of printmaking?

While most linoleum carving sets are designed primarily for linoleum or soft rubber blocks, many blades and tools can be adapted for other relief printing materials like soft foam or rubber. However, harder materials such as wood require specialized tools with more robust blades. Check the specifications of each set to ensure compatibility with your intended projects, and avoid forcing softer tools into harder materials to prevent damage.
